# Transport: Locked Case of Test Devices

The Norrell lab sends a locked aluminium case of test handsets to the Bramfield office each quarter. Case stays sealed in transit; only the office manager holds the key. Courier collects from the lab's front desk, signs the transit slip, and delivers same day. Log the seal number on dispatch and receipt. At collection, give the courier this instruction:

drop instructions, bawep-tahaf: the praix belion courier leaves the lamix holdor tamwyn kasix tamael ulays wenath wenox ledger at gate 6249 under passcode 007677

Undo and redo in Sketchforge use a command stack. Every mutation implements apply() and revert(). Do not mutate canvas state directly; route through CommandBus or history breaks. Redo stack clears on any new command. Review checklist: commands must be deterministic, revert must be exact inverse, and batch operations wrap in a CompositeCommand. Snapshots persist to the history table every 50 commands for crash recovery. To inspect persisted snapshots locally, connect to the dev history database with the following string.

replica DSN, kajep-yahag: mssql://praok_svc:iF@db-8d68.plorvaio.local:5432/eliion

Subject: Rebalancer DR drill next Tuesday

Plugin authors: next Tuesday we run a disaster-recovery drill for Spokeshift, the bike-share rebalancing tool. The dispatch API will fail over to the Harrowgate standby region; expect stale dock-fill data for roughly an hour. Plugins should degrade gracefully rather than retry aggressively. To open the drill credentials vault, use the recovery passphrase below.

vault phrase of tawig-taduf = zorath-oliwyn

**Turnstile Upgrade — Facilities Desk Brief**

The lobby turnstiles at Ashenvale Court have been replaced with the new Glintgate optical lanes. Staff badges now tap on the top reader rather than the side panel. Expect a short adjustment period; keep the manual gate available for wheelchair users and deliveries. If a lane faults, power-cycle it from the control cabinet behind the desk before logging a ticket. The cabinet and the override panel both open with the code below.

staff pass of kagef-yahip = bdg-TKELFT-63915354